#3455be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3455be is composed of 20.4% red, 33.3% green and 74.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.6% cyan, 55.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 225.7 degrees, a saturation of 57% and a lightness of 47.5%. #3455be color hex could be obtained by blending #68aaff with #00007d.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#3455be

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010205 is the darkest color, while #f5f7f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#3455be

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#75777d is the less saturated color, while #053ded is the most saturated one.
